Form time to time my site show diffrent type error message page . I dont want site users to see this page. I figure that it has something to do with changing the Webconfig file - but how?

Yes, you can change the error message to point to a html page, using something like:-

CUSTOMERRORS mode="RemoteOnly" defaultRedirect="mycustompage.htm"

(in web.config)
